6 NH Stop & Shop Stores, 3 Gas Stations To Close Friday
MANCHESTER, N.H. (CBS/AP) ---- Six New Hampshire Stop & Shop supermarkets and three gas stations will close for good Friday night.
The company that owns the stores, Stop & Shop Supermarket LLC said earlier this month, the stores were not meeting performance goals.
The stores will permanently close their doors at 9 p.m. Friday.
"We deeply appreciate and thank our associates for their years of service and dedication to the communities of Southern New Hampshire. We thank our loyal customers for their patronage and appreciate the opportunity to have served since 2003," the company said in a statement.
The company said it will work with union and local officials to provide job search assistance to workers affected by the closings.
The stores being closed are in Bedford, Hudson, Exeter, Milford, and Manchester.
It's not clear how many jobs are being lost. The company said it employs about 63,000 associates and operates more than 400 stores throughout Massachusetts, Connecticut, Rhode Island, New Hampshire, New York, and New Jersey.
